      • Résumé :
        Creativity will be one of the top three skills needed by 2020 according to the World Economic Forum. Creativity Cycling is written for leaders who want to help their team solve complex problems by applying creative thinking skills. In a fast-changing world, new challenges frequently arise and complex problems benefit from creative thinking revealing new perspectives and opportunities. This book provides an overview of the conditions for creativity, both individual and team, and presents a tried and tested creative process for solving complex problems and envisioning the future. It is written for leaders who want to enable their team to work creatively in responding to challenges. Many people have analytical tools they've acquired through formal studies or work experience that they apply when faced with a challenging situation. Indeed, organisations have extensive experience in applying rational and analytical skills such as data mining, correlation analysis, scenario analysis and forecasting, to name a few. These are all valuable and have their place. Organisations sometimes lack knowledge or experience of using other tools and processes such as creative tools. In this book the authors describe our favourite creative exercises and how we've used them for solving complex problems and envisioning the future.
